Record 1, Textual support, English
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 DEF
The capacity of a material, structural component or structure to withstand fire without losing its fire-separating or load-bearing strength ... usually expressed in terms of a time period. 4, record 1, English, - fire%20resistance
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 CONT
A long history of over 150 years of excellent performance in numerous severe fires has established the superior fire endurance of heavy timber framing. 5, record 1, English, - fire%20resistance

Record 2, Textual support, English
Record number: 2, Textual support number: 1 DEF
A value expressed in hours, or parts of an hour, interpreted by the agency having the authority or by an independent testing laboratory, during which a building or building materials are tested for structural integrity or effectively withstand destruction when exposed to fire. 8, record 2, English, - fire%20endurance%20rating

Record 2, Textual support, French
Record number: 2, Textual support number: 1 DEF
Durée, exprimée en heures et fraction d’heure, pendant laquelle un élément de construction peut jouer en toute sécurité le rôle qui lui est dévolu, dans un bâtiment soumis à l’action d’un incendie. Elle est comptée depuis le début de l’essai de réaction au feu jusqu’au moment où la défaillance survient. 4, record 2, French, - degr%C3%A9%20de%20r%C3%A9sistance%20au%20feu
